117.info
人生若只如初见

sql如何实现对密码字段加密

在SQL中实现对密码字段加密的方法有很多种,以下是其中一种常见的方法:

  1. 使用加密函数:可以使用内置的加密函数如MD5、SHA1等来对密码字段进行加密。例如,可以使用MD5函数对密码进行加密存储:
UPDATE users SET password = MD5('password') WHERE user_id = 1;
  1. 使用加密算法库:可以使用数据库提供的加密算法库或第三方加密算法库来对密码进行加密。例如,可以使用AES加密算法对密码进行加密:
UPDATE users SET password = AES_ENCRYPT('password', 'key') WHERE user_id = 1;
  1. 使用哈希函数:可以使用哈希函数如SHA256、SHA512等对密码进行哈希存储。例如,可以使用SHA256函数对密码进行哈希存储:
UPDATE users SET password = SHA256('password') WHERE user_id = 1;

需要注意的是,加密仅仅是一种保护数据的方式,虽然加密后的密码无法直接被读取,但仍然可以被破解。因此,除了加密外,还应该采取其他措施来确保密码的安全,如加盐、定期更新密码等。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e43fAzsICQJXA10.html

推荐文章

  • sql文件如何导入数据库

    SQL文件可以通过多种方式导入到数据库中,以下是其中几种常见的方法: 使用命令行工具:可以使用命令行工具如mysql来导入SQL文件。在命令行中输入以下命令: mys...

  • sql字符串怎么转换为数字排序

    要将包含数字和字母的字符串转换为数字排序,可以使用SQL中的CAST函数将字符串转换为数字,然后进行排序。以下是一个示例:
    假设有一个包含数字和字母的字符...

  • sql中schema的应用场景有哪些

    在SQL中,schema的应用场景包括但不限于以下几个方面: 数据库设计:schema定义了数据库中的表结构、字段以及数据类型,帮助数据库管理员进行数据库设计和管理。...

  • sql中schema的使用方法是什么

    在SQL中,schema是指数据库中的逻辑结构,它包含了数据库对象(如表、视图、索引等)的定义和组织方式。schema的使用方法如下: 创建schema:可以使用CREATE SCH...

  • mongodb单表最大容量怎么查看

    在MongoDB中,可以使用以下命令来查看单个集合(表)的大小:
    db.collection.stats() 其中,collection是要查看的集合的名称。这条命令将返回包含集合大小等...

  • 怎么用python读取网页上的数据

    要读取网页上的数据,可以使用Python的requests库来发送HTTP请求来获取网页内容。以下是一个简单的例子:
    import requests url = 'https://www.example.com...

  • python中read_csv的使用方法是什么

    在Python中,可以使用pandas库来读取csv文件。使用pandas库中的read_csv函数可以方便地读取csv文件并将其转换为DataFrame对象。read_csv函数的基本用法如下:

  • python怎么批量读取csv文件

    要批量读取多个csv文件,可以使用Python中的glob模块来获取所有csv文件的文件路径,然后使用pandas库来逐个读取这些csv文件。
    以下是一个示例代码:
    i...